This years line up for Mayhem is insane! This is the first festival where I wanted to see every band on the line up perform. One of those must see bands for me was Megadeth! I have seen these guys play all over the United States at many different venue’s, and it’s always the same thing of kick ass riffs and guitar solo’s at high volumes! Even their crazy unplugged acoustic performance in the KBPI studio back in 2001 was kick ass riffs and guitar solo’s at high volumes!
Megadeth’s performance didn’t disappoint, they even give a Dave Mustaine’s guitar away in the middle of the set! Dave basically hands the lucky winner the guitar off his back! Check out the Mayhem Fest website for details on this insanity!
As the festival was wrapping up, I was back stage waiting for Disturbed to hit the stage and out walks Megadeth’s bass player Dave Ellefson wearing the OTR-WML t-shirt! It was so badass to see this. I had a chance early that day to talk with Dave about his favorite record store experience and to let him check out the book and the details of the project. This was one of the most coolest and down to earth people you could meet. I’m very thankful to see such a great musician supporting the project, and wearing the t-shirt!
